Searched refs:ifi_addr (Results 1 - 3 of 3) sorted by relevance

/external/mdnsresponder/mDNSPosix/
H A DmDNSUNP.c143 ifi->ifi_addr = calloc(1, sizeof(struct sockaddr_in6));
144 if (ifi->ifi_addr == NULL) {
147 memcpy(ifi->ifi_addr, res0->ai_addr, sizeof(struct sockaddr_in6));
153 if (ifi->ifi_addr == NULL) {
181 free(ifi->ifi_addr);
341 if (ifi->ifi_addr == NULL) {
342 ifi->ifi_addr = (struct sockaddr*)calloc(1, sizeof(struct sockaddr_in));
343 if (ifi->ifi_addr == NULL) {
346 memcpy(ifi->ifi_addr, sinptr, sizeof(struct sockaddr_in));
356 free(ifi->ifi_addr);
[all...]
H A DmDNSUNP.h92 struct sockaddr *ifi_addr; /* primary address */ member in struct:ifi_info
110 #define IFI_ALIAS 1 /* ifi_addr is an alias */
H A DmDNSPosix.c961 if ( ((i->ifi_addr->sa_family == AF_INET)
963 || (i->ifi_addr->sa_family == AF_INET6)
974 if (SetupOneInterface(m, i->ifi_addr, i->ifi_netmask, i->ifi_name, i->ifi_index) == 0)
975 if (i->ifi_addr->sa_family == AF_INET)
988 (void) SetupOneInterface(m, firstLoopback->ifi_addr, firstLoopback->ifi_netmask, firstLoopback->ifi_name, firstLoopback->ifi_index);

Completed in 106 milliseconds